When you stitch on the afghan material, how does the back get finished? I love your videos and projects. I prefer 16 count aida.
@UntwistyourStitches
@UntwistyourStitches Месяц назад
@ccockrum59 what I have done with the backs of the afghans is get a light flannel that compliments the stitching and sew it to the back. I will leave several inches of the afghan fabric and fringe that. I sew the outside edges and then around each square to keep the backing steady.

Gorgeous does not cover how pretty that quilt is!! I'm making stockings for my daughter's. Do you have any tips on securing the stitches for functional finishes? I'm nervous my stitches will come loose after one machine wash.
@UntwistyourStitches
@UntwistyourStitches 3 месяца назад
@@theokiestitcher The way I secure my stitches is to run the needle under 5 to 6 stitches then turn the needle skip the last stitch you just ran under and run the needle back under the 5 stitches. I wash pretty much everything I stitch and all my threads have stayed anchored.
